The 2025 Peony International Communication Forum has kicked off in Heze, a city in east China’s Shandong Province known as the “Peony Capital.” The event gathers diplomats, artists, and scholars from around the world to celebrate the peony’s significance in cultural diplomacy.

Participants are exploring how the vibrant flower, a symbol of harmony and prosperity in Chinese culture, can bridge cultures and inspire global connections. Workshops, exhibitions, and performances are showcasing the peony’s role in art, literature, and international exchange.

“The peony is more than just a flower; it’s a cultural ambassador,” said one attendee. “By sharing its beauty, we hope to foster mutual understanding and friendship among nations.”

The forum reflects China’s efforts to promote cultural diversity and engage in meaningful dialogue with the international community. For many young people, the event offers a unique opportunity to connect with peers from different backgrounds and discover shared values through the universal language of art and nature.
